Cancer Registrar II
Dana-Farber Cancer Institute Boston, MA, USA
Job Ref:JR-2072 Location:21 27 Burlington Ave, BOSTON, MA 02215 Category:Health Info Svs/Records/Coding Employment Type:Full time Work Location:Remote: 100% off site Salary/Pay Rate:$73,100.00 - $80,700.00 per year Overview Under the direct supervision of the DF/BCC Associate Director, this position is primarily responsible for identifying, registering, and abstracting patients with cancer. This includes reviewing and analyzing hospital records and other medical records for relevant cancer data; determining and classifying demographics, primary site, histology, stage, and treatment on all cancer sites and performing annual patient follow-up as needed. Data collection will meet the standards of the Commission on Cancer of the American College of Surgeons, the Massachusetts State Cancer Registry, the New Hampshire State Cancer Registry, the DF/BCC Cancer Registry, Disease Centers, clinicians, researchers and administrators. Certified Tumor Registrar
North Mississippi Health Services Tupelo, MS, USA
Reporting: Examine medical and pathology records to code the complete history, diagnosis, treatment, and health status for malignant or neoplastic diseases diagnosed and/or treated in this institution. Capture and report data from all medical facilities that treat cancer patients. Compile reports for monthly submission to Mississippi Cancer Registry. Examine accuracy and consistency of coded data required to monitor and advance cancer treatments. Maintain accurate and current database of cancer information used to conduct research and improve cancer preventative and screening methods. Resolve and submit Edit Reports to the National Cancer Data Base (NCDB), Rapid Quality Reporting System (RQRS) and Mississippi Cancer Registry.
